Aisha at The Stable, Bristol
See event details

A gig on Friday 1st July. The event starts at 22:00.


Aisha is a British singer, songwriter of Libyan descent who’s passion for music and singing was inspired by listening to artists such as Erykah Badu, The Roots and Jill Scott.

Aisha has created a raw soulful sound to encompass her deep and heart felt lyrics which draw upon her own life experiences and living between two different cultures.
